36.(a) Simple interest = (54,000×8×6)/100 = ₹25,920.
37.(a) Cost price = 1,610/1.15 = ₹1,400.
38.(a) Total of 45 numbers = 45×58 = 2,610; total of remaining 44 = 44×56 = 2,464; removed number = 2,610−2,464 = 146.
39.(a) The parts total 19+15 = 34; each part = 1,020/34 = 30; larger share = 19×30 = ₹570.
40.(a) The number = 1,700/0.85 = 2,000.
41.(a) Total distance = 260+210 = 470 km; total time = 4+3 = 7 hours; average speed = 470/7 ≈ 67.14 km/h.
42.(a) Amount = 54,000×(1.05)² = 59,535; compound interest = ₹5,535.
43.(a) Combined fill rate = 1/8+1/15−1/40 = 15/120+8/120−3/120 = 20/120 = 1/6, so together they take 6 minutes.
44.(a) Downstream speed = 14+2 = 16 km/h; time = 96/16 = 6 hours.
45.(a) Each term is multiplied by 3: 6×3=18, 18×3=54, 54×3=162, 162×3=486.
46.(a) Profit = 850−680 = ₹170; profit percentage = (170/680)×100 = 25%.
47.(a) Let B's present age be x and A's be 2x; nine years ago, 2x−9 = 3(x−9), giving 2x−9 = 3x−27, so x=18.
48.(a) 19(x−16)=11x+16 gives 19x−304=11x+16, so 8x=320, x=40.
49.(a) Area = 78×55 = 4,290 sq cm.
50.(a) The parts total 24+17 = 41; each part = 656/41 = 16; larger number = 24×16 = 384.
51.(a) A's share is 1.4 times B's (40% more), giving a 7:5 ratio; each of the 12 parts = 42,000/12 = 3,500, so B's share = 5×3,500 = ₹17,500.
52.(a) The average of the first n natural numbers is (n+1)/2, so the average of the first 300 is 301/2 = 150.5.
53.(a) Selling price = 36,000×0.78 = ₹28,080.
54.(a) Each term follows ×2+2: 18×2+2=38, 38×2+2=78, 78×2+2=158, 158×2+2=318.
55.(a) A:B ratio = (1,60,000×7):(1,40,000×8) = 11,20,000:11,20,000 = 1:1.
56.(a) A sum becoming eleven times itself means the interest earned equals ten times the principal; rate = (10×100)/100 = 10% per annum.
57.(a) Side of the square = √1,089 = 33 cm; perimeter = 4×33 = 132 cm.
58.(a) Speed = 400 m / 20 s = 20 m/s = 20×18/5 = 72 km/h.
59.(a) x²−26x+165=0 factorises as (x−11)(x−15)=0, giving roots 11 and 15; the smaller root is 11.
60.(a) Marking 90% above cost price and giving a 20% discount gives selling price = CP×1.90×0.80 = 1.52×CP, a net profit of 52%.
61.(a) The average of the first n odd natural numbers equals n, so the average of the first 66 odd numbers is 66.
62.(a) A's share is 3.5 times B's (250% more), giving a 7:2 ratio; each of the 9 parts = 54,000/9 = 6,000, so B's share = 2×6,000 = ₹12,000.
63.(a) Combined fill rate = 1/8+1/15−1/40 = 15/120+8/120−3/120 = 20/120 = 1/6, so together they take 6 minutes.
64.(a) The differences between consecutive terms are 13, 26, and 52, each obtained as (previous difference ×2); the next difference is 52×2 = 104, giving 101+104 = 205.
65.(a) Let A's age nine years ago be 5k and B's be 7k; their present ages are 5k+9 and 7k+9, in the ratio 3:4, giving 4(5k+9)=3(7k+9), so 20k+36=21k+27, k=9; A's present age = 5(9)+9 = 54 years.
